Great amount of wok on TROMjaro these days. @Roma worked like nuts! Then @Rokosun came to help. Both fantastic creatures. Our scripts look way better now. Before we had to run them every few seconds (bad), now we trigger them based on relevant changes of the system. This result in instant actions.
So, let me repeat, we are able to sync the system's theme, icon pack, and font, across GTK, GTK + LIbadwaita, Qt, QT5, QT6, and Flatpaks (the ones that support it). This is USABILITY, not simply fancy shit. And it works. Instantly. Makes the desktop fuckin' sane.

Someone who wants to join our Friendica instance asked me if ours is blocked by other instances. Well...see folks!? How can I know!? On the fediverse any admin can block any instance without you and me having a clue if, what and when they do so.
I keep on telling you, this practice is ruining the fediverse as a whole. It is almost like burning down forests becasue you found some weeds.
We need a way to know who blocked what. Not only what my instance blocked, but what instances blocked mine.
However the best practice is not blocking instances at the admin level, EXCEPT when an instance is clearly full of spam-bots. Let the users decide for themselves what they want to block. There are many proposed solutions out there as to how we can deal with unwanted content, such as: disable the global timeline, shorter lifespan for remote items (so you don't really host any remote content), blocklists enforced by admins but that can be overwritten by users, or adblock-like lists that any user can easily apply for themselves.
